NEW From SIMCO Industrial Static Control...Contact Cleaning Systems



Hatfield, Pennsylvania - NEW from SIMCO the QuadClam, HexClam, QuadClean and HexClean clamshell design contact cleaning systems.

The QuadClam and HexClam are 4 and 6 roll contact cleaners with a clamshell design. The systems remove particulate from both the top and bottom web-surface. The QuadClam and HexClam allow the top-half of the cleaner assembly to open and the tape-roll to slide out on a drawer. This greatly facilitates tape maintenance and web threading. The HexClam is available to 24" and the QuadClam is for 30"- 60" widths.

The QuadClean and HexClean are basic 4-roll and 6-roll assemblies for both top and bottom web-surface cleaning. The HexClean is available to 24" wide and the QuadClean for 30" to 60" widths.

Features:
o Quick release gudgeons for quick removal of tapes.
o Air cylinders engage & separate rolls.
o Anti-Static bar and power supply for easy particulate removal
o Operator panel remotely mounted
o Speed: 500 fpm on narrow webs and up to 500 fpm on wide webs
o Rugged SS/AL construction with Plexiglas safety covers

Contact Cleaning
Product waste results from dust and particulate contamination on surfaces of film, paper, or other substrates. Small particles adhere to the web surface due to static electricity, moisture, etc. These particles lower your product quality, cost you money, cause production loss and dissatisfied customers. Vacuum systems are generally effective in removing contaminants down to 20 micron in size. Simco's Narrow Web Contact Cleaning Systems can remove particles from 20 down to 1 micron. Using CCRs in a nip configuration, the CCR applies from 0.5 to 2 psi pressure on the web, squeezing out the boundary layer of air. Performance evaluations reveal a cleaning efficiency of 97% of particles down to 10 micron in size and removal of most particles to 1 micron in size.
